Community Participation in Bellbird Park

How people contribute — volunteering, unpaid care and domestic work, and defence service.

Over a third of people in Bellbird Park provide unpaid childcare, a figure well above the national average. While family care is a major part of local life, other forms of community involvement and volunteering are less common here.

Participation

Volunteering for organisations and groups.

Only 10.7% of residents volunteer, which is well below the 14.1% seen across both Queensland and Australia.

10.7%

Lower than 78% of statistical area 2 (sa2) areas.

Share of people aged 15+ who did voluntary work for an organisation or group.

Unpaid care & work

Caring for others and unpaid domestic work.

Providing unpaid care for children is very common, with 35.4% of people doing so, which is well above the national figure of 26.3%. However, other unpaid care and housework are less frequent, with 10.7% of people providing general unpaid care, a little below the Australian average.

Defence service

People who served in the Australian Defence Force.

A high 4.1% of the population have served in the Defence Force, which is much higher than most similar areas and a little above the Australian figure of 2.8%.
